Glendale joins thousands at Phoenix Festival

On Saturday 9th May, Glendale joined Phoenix Community Housing Group for their seventh annual Phoenix Festival in Forster Memorial Park, Lewisham.

The event, held every year, sees thousands of members of the local community come together to enjoy a wide array of stalls and activities from face painting and arts and crafts to rock climbing and live music.

Glendale support Phoenix Community Housing Group in organising and delivering the show every year and the grounds team worked hard in the days leading up to the event to ensure the venue was in perfect condition for the visitors.

This year, as well as running a competition to win a selection of flowers and herbs, volunteers from the company’s Surrey-based arboriculture contract hosted a tree climbing activity for the younger visitors.  The team set up their harnesses, ropes and safety equipment in a tree in order to demonstrate safe climbing techniques and let the children have a go at being an arborist.
